Last Poems Houseman, A. E. [Near Fine] [Hardcover]
12mo., 79pp. Beautiful First Edition of this collection of poetry from the author of ""A Shropshire Lad"". Bound in blue cloth with titles in gold on spine and front board. Top edge gilt. Square, tight and clean throughout with little or no wear. A few spots of light toning to cloth. Unclipped, though unpriced, dust-jacket, (""Five shillings net"" on front panel), has chips to spine panel and edges. Wear to edges and tips and a 3"" closed tear on the front panel. Soiling, Not perfect but complete and scarce in any condition. A very pretty collectable copy and surprisingly uncommon even without the scarce dust-jacket,
Fletch's Moxie. A novel. GREGORY MCDONALD. [Near Fine] [Hardcover]
The first UK and the first casebound edition, published the year after the US edition which only appeared in paperback format. 8vo. 283pp. Red boards lettered in gold at the spine. Three or four tiny areas of minute blemishing to the top edge, else a fine copy in virtually fine price-clipped dust wrapper. The fifth of the author's series of 'Fletch' novels.

[Signed] American Dirt. A novel. (SIGNED) JEANINE CUMMINS. [Near Fine] [Hardcover]
First UK Edition (first printing), issued the same year as the US edition. This copy signed by the author on a special leaf tipped before the title page. 8vo. 472pp. White cloth lettered in blue at the spine, with a blue-stamped decoration to the upper board and patterned endpapers. A tiny crease to the corner tips of three adjacent text leaves, else a fine copy in very lightly edgeworn non-price-clipped dust wrapper. The author's third novel, a much hyped best seller which was also heavily criticised for cultural exploitation.
